Output 17a3ccd709d40d50872630f5031a0deee0385157ced451ba545ef4fbf06da919:0

value
6042676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a6098bab330a7c7f8973d15115f5fd0e3527b0 OP_EQUALVERIFY OP_CHECKSIG
address
1DYpUkibrMyND7HxMAzAVLXDimJCrUMqTM
transaction
17a3ccd709d40d50872630f5031a0deee0385157ced451ba545ef4fbf06da919
spent
true